How to maximize sunlight in a greenhouse?
To optimize greenhouse lighting, consider the following factors:
- Ensure the greenhouse is positioned to receive maximum sunlight, with south-facing orientations being most effective in the Northern Hemisphere. Minimize obstructions like trees or buildings.
- Use light-transmitting materials like glass or polycarbonate for high light transmission. Regularly clean the coverings to prevent dust buildup.
- Install light-diffusing materials or shade cloths to ensure even light distribution.
- In regions with limited sunlight or winter months, supplement natural sunlight with artificial lighting like LED grow lights. These energy-efficient lights mimic the intensity and duration of natural sunlight, promoting healthy plant development.

How do you keep a greenhouse cool in extreme heat?
Natural ventilation in greenhouses is essential for optimal cooling, humidity removal, and air mixing. To ensure proper functioning, use side vents in addition to roof vents, open doors, use open weave interior shade screens, turn off air circulation fans, and add a skirt to rollup sidewalls. Maintenance is crucial, including checking fan belts for wear and tension, cleaning fan blades, and lubricating shutters.
Redirect air circulation fan flow by directing all HAF fans to blow from shutter end to fan end, sealing cracks, and closing doors to maximize air flow through the crop. Save energy by staging fans using two stage thermostats or an electronic controller, selecting NEMA premium motors with an efficiency of 86. Clean insect screening by spraying water from inside or vacuuming from outside to remove dust, leaves, insects, and other obstructions.
Use evaporative cooling to lower greenhouse temperatures to several degrees below outside ambient, using portable evaporative coolers that are easy to set up. Maintain fan and pad systems by keeping them clean of dirt and debris, flushing or bleeding off some water and adding an algaecide. Nozzle clogging on fog systems from chemical and particulate matter can be controlled using rain or treated water.
In summary, proper greenhouse ventilation systems should provide cooling, humidity removal, and air mixing, with maintenance and evaporative cooling being key components.

Is it better for a greenhouse to get morning or afternoon sun?
Greenhouses can be oriented East or West, depending on their preference. East-facing greenhouses receive morning sunlight, providing warmth and early growth, while protecting them from intense afternoon sun. They are ideal for plants that prefer cooler temperatures or are sensitive to excessive heat. However, they may have limited sunlight exposure in the afternoon and evening, potentially affecting Mediterranean crops’ growth and fruiting.
West-facing greenhouses, on the other hand, receive afternoon and evening sunlight, maximizing light exposure during peak growing hours. They also offer warmer temperatures in the afternoon and extended daylight hours in summer, allowing for longer growing seasons.
